#7ed27c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7ed27c is composed of 49.4% red, 82.4%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40% cyan, 0% magenta, 41%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 118.6 degrees, a saturation of 48.9% and a lightness of 65.5%. #7ed27c color hex could be obtained by blending #fcfff8 with #00a500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#7ed27c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7ed27c has RGB values of R:126, G:210,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 8311420.

Shades and Tints of #7ed27c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f1faf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7ed27c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a5a9a5 is the less saturated color, while #57fb53 is the most saturated one.
